Links and chains

Links and chains

This long 30 inch asymmetrical necklace was made with a variety of silver links, some of which are smooth, some I oxidized, others I pierced and made bubble links and some are hammered with a hole in the center.

They are all linked together with a few chains in between some.

Perfect weight, perfect with anything you choose to wear and for all occasions. The necklace ties with a lobster clasp.
